A 30-YEAR-OLD man from Abergavenny was arrested on suspicion of trespass and received a police caution on Sunday.
British Transport Police were called to Abergavenny rail station at just before 3pm on Sunday, March 29 to reports of a person hit by a train.
Officers located a man near the railway line who was uninjured and had not been struck by a train.
Arriva Trains Wales said cancellations had been made to services between Hereford and Abergavenny and trains were delayed by 60 minutes. Normal services resumed at around 5pm.
A spokesman for British Transport Police said: "The 30-year-old man, from Abergavenny, was arrested on suspicion of trespass at the scene and received a police caution.”
